Chapter 114

Marc couldn't have said what led him to the farmhouse in the middle of nowhere. He'd never seen the place before, and yet something had compelled him to come here. As he stared at the sagging porch, the peeling wooden boards paneling the exterior of the house, and the curled shingles on the roof, he couldn't help a sense of dŽjˆ vu.

Why does this place seem so familiar?

Why did he feel drawn to it? Actually he knew why. Signs of their presence and smell was everywhere. Rogues used to live here, but he doubted any did anymore. Not living ones at any rate, or so his wolf assured him. He'd yet to change back to his man form. Why would he? No clothes. No wallet. No reason. Best to stay as an animal for now. Maybe if he got lucky, a hunter would shoot him.

Although, he doubted it would happen here. Death had already visited and taken its due.

A few bodies littered the property, some of the mangled corpses partially hidden in the tall grass heavily speckled with weeds
